divorcing

word · lemma: divorce

Definition

Divorcing means ending a marriage through a legal process. It describes what people are doing when they separate legally as husband and wife.

Usage & Nuances

Used as the present participle or continuous form of 'divorce.' Common in contexts about marriage and relationships, often followed by 'from' (e.g., 'divorcing from her husband'). Used for both men and women; more formal than casual breakup.
